An original 1890 etching in black ink on ivory wove paper by listed American landscape artist George W. Bohde (19th century). The print depicts a rural landscape. A wide, bright stream curves through a grassy landscape, and a squat cottage sits along the left bank of the water, surrounded by a grove of tall trees. Delicate linework adds layers of texture across the print. The print is signed, dated, and labeled ‘NY’ in-plate to the lower left. The print is presented behind antique hand-rolled glass in a natural-stained wooden frame with a thin strip of gold tone inner trim. A hanging wire is attached to the verso for hanging.
